The country's country calling code is +966. Saudi Arabia's numbering plan is the following: [1] 011 XXX XXXX - Riyadh & the greater central region; 012 XXX XXXX - Western region, includes Makkah, Jeddah, Taif, Rabigh; 013 XXX XXXX- The Eastern Province, which includes, Dammam, Khobar, Qatif, Jubail, Dhahran, Hafar al-Batin & others; 014 XXX XXXX - Al-Madinah, Tabuk, Al-Jawf, Yanbu, Turaif ...

Calling Saudi Arabia explained: 011 - international prefix; dial first when calling abroad from the US or Canada. 966 - Country Code for Saudi Arabia. Phone Number (remove initial 0) - 9 digits. example call from the United States or from Canada to a landline in Riyadh: 011 966 11 ??? ????
